Output e8c3e641322c57cb0f75b4460cb3786323b763093a389ce9225acddeee0f1d52:1

value
1666368
script pubkey
OP_0 OP_PUSHBYTES_20 e5c4718bbeb276f159cd955c0f31ef32a2575ecf
address
ltc1quhz8rza7kfm0zkwdj4wq7v00x239whk0q60v5l
transaction
e8c3e641322c57cb0f75b4460cb3786323b763093a389ce9225acddeee0f1d52
spent
true